What is Calcium Hydroxyapatite?

Calcium Hydroxyapatite (CaHA) is a naturally occurring mineral form of calcium apatite, primarily found in human bones and teeth. In the realm of medical aesthetics, this substance serves as a dermal filler due to its unique properties. Calcium Hydroxyapatite has a robust ability to provide volume and support to various areas of the body, making it particularly suitable for buttock augmentation. It acts as a scaffold for collagen production, allowing the body to gradually absorb the filler while promoting natural tissue growth.

This material’s biocompatibility makes it a preferred choice for many dermatologists and cosmetic surgeons, as it poses minimal risk of adverse reactions. Unlike other fillers, Calcium Hydroxyapatite offers a more substantial and longer-lasting effect, as it integrates well with surrounding tissues. With its dual action of providing immediate volume and stimulating natural collagen, Calcium Hydroxyapatite Buttock Augmentation stands out in the competitive field of aesthetic enhancements.

The Procedure

The procedure for Calcium Hydroxyapatite Buttock Augmentation begins with a thorough consultation where the patient’s goals and expectations are discussed. A detailed assessment of the buttock area is conducted, ensuring that the treatment plan aligns with the desired outcome. After establishing a customized approach, the area is cleaned and marked for injection sites.

Next, a local anesthetic is administered to minimize discomfort during the procedure. The practitioner then injects Calcium Hydroxyapatite using a fine needle, strategically placing the filler to enhance volume and shape. The injection technique requires precision to achieve symmetrical and aesthetically pleasing results. Typically, the procedure lasts around 30 to 60 minutes, depending on the extent of augmentation desired.

Post-procedure, patients receive detailed care instructions, emphasizing the importance of avoiding strenuous activities for a few days. Mild swelling or bruising may occur but usually resolves within a week. Patients often appreciate the immediate results, with continued improvement as collagen develops in the treated areas. Follow-up appointments allow for adjustments if necessary, ensuring optimal outcomes.

Risks and Considerations

Despite the many benefits of Calcium Hydroxyapatite Buttock Augmentation, potential risks and considerations must be addressed. While complications are rare, they can include swelling, bruising, and tenderness at the injection sites. In some cases, patients may experience more significant reactions, such as infection or allergic responses, highlighting the importance of choosing a qualified practitioner.

To minimize risks, patients should adhere strictly to pre-procedure instructions, such as avoiding blood thinners and alcohol before treatment. Post-procedure care is equally crucial, as patients should refrain from vigorous exercise and avoid direct pressure on the treated areas. Monitoring for any unusual symptoms is also essential; immediate communication with the provider can help address any concerns promptly.

Patients with specific medical conditions, such as bleeding disorders or autoimmune diseases, should consult their healthcare provider to ensure the procedure is appropriate for them. Understanding these factors allows individuals to make informed decisions regarding their aesthetic goals while prioritizing their health and safety.

Comparing Calcium Hydroxyapatite with Other Fillers

When considering buttock augmentation, comparing Calcium Hydroxyapatite with other fillers reveals unique benefits. Hyaluronic acid (HA), one of the most commonly used fillers, provides immediate volume but lacks the stimulating properties that Calcium Hydroxyapatite offers. While HA fillers may last around six to twelve months, Calcium Hydroxyapatite can achieve longer-lasting results due to its ability to promote collagen growth.

Moreover, Calcium Hydroxyapatite tends to offer a firmer texture, which can be particularly advantageous for areas requiring more structure, such as the buttocks. Patients often note a more natural look and feel with Calcium Hydroxyapatite, contributing to higher satisfaction rates. Additionally, the dual action of immediate filling and gradual improvement makes it a superior option for those seeking both instant results and long-term benefits.

In summary, while many fillers serve specific purposes, Calcium Hydroxyapatite Buttock Augmentation stands out due to its unique properties and enhanced results. Understanding these differences enables patients to choose the best option for their individual needs and desired outcomes.

How does Calcium Hydroxyapatite work for buttock augmentation?

Calcium Hydroxyapatite works by providing immediate volume to the treated area upon injection. Once injected, the filler integrates with the surrounding tissue and stimulates collagen production, enhancing the structure and firmness of the buttocks over time. This dual action not only improves the immediate appearance but also contributes to a more sustained result as the body gradually incorporates the filler. The procedure is typically performed in an outpatient setting, requiring minimal downtime and allowing patients to resume normal activities shortly after treatment.
